Read the planets before the angle

An aspect never works in a vacuum. Identify the two planetary functions first, then read how the angle changes the tone between them.

Square describes the mechanics of contact, but the actual themes come from the planets and houses involved.

Natal charts and transits

In a natal chart, an aspect describes a recurring inner dynamic. In transits, it often shows temporary pressure, activation, or a window for action.
